- Diana PekelAug 22, 2024 · 2 years agoMomentum trading and swing trading are two popular strategies used in the cryptocurrency market. Momentum trading involves buying assets that are already showing an upward trend and selling them when the trend starts to reverse. This strategy aims to take advantage of short-term price movements and capitalize on market momentum. One advantage of momentum trading is the potential for quick profits, as it allows traders to ride the wave of a strong trend. However, it also carries the risk of buying at the peak and selling at the bottom, as trends can change rapidly. Swing trading, on the other hand, focuses on capturing shorter-term price swings within a larger trend. Traders using this strategy aim to buy at the low point of a swing and sell at the high point, profiting from the oscillations in price. One advantage of swing trading is the potential for higher returns compared to momentum trading, as it allows traders to capture multiple swings within a trend. However, it requires more active monitoring and decision-making, as traders need to identify and time their entries and exits accurately. Both strategies have their advantages and disadvantages, and the choice between them depends on individual trading preferences and risk tolerance.
